Journalists are charged with dangerous tasks in the battlefields
of war, and in areas of armed conflict, since the coverage of armed
conflict oblige them to be present in areas of enmity or in areas of
occupation, posing a threat to their physical safety and personal
freedom. therefore the provisions of Islamic law and the rules of
international humanitarian law imposed principles and
mechanisms to protect this segment through which the parties to
the armed conflict and all actors in the field to respect and seek to
implement them, the journalist as a peaceful civilian person is not
a part to the clash, what calls for protection against military attacks
is Preceded to the provisions of Islamic law before the emergence
of the so-called international humanitarian law . |
